THE Department of Health has reported that there have been no Coronavirus-related deaths recorded in the North of Ireland in the past 24 hours.
It is the fourth day in a row that a daily update from the DoH has recorded no new deaths in a 24-hour period.
The total number of deaths recorded by the department remains at 537.
This figure is mostly focused on hospital deaths.
A total of 13 further people have tested positive for Covid-19, bringing the total of confirmed cases to 4,818, according to the department’s dashboard.
There have been 27 deaths in the Derry City and Strabane District Council area since the pandemic started in March and there have been 177 positive cases within the council boundary.
